#499df7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#499df7 is composed of 28.6% red, 61.6%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.4% cyan, 36.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 211 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 62.7%. #499df7 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#003bef.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#499df7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000306 is the darkest color, while #f2f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#499df7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99a0a7 is the less saturated color, while #429dfe is the most saturated one.
